Regulatory Approvals
The deal will also need to get the green light from regulators, which can take time and potentially lead to changes in the deal's terms. Regulatory approvals are crucial for the acquisition to proceed, requiring compliance with antitrust laws and other relevant regulations. Regulators examine the deal for potential impacts on market competition, fair pricing, and consumer interests. The process can be lengthy, involving reviews by various agencies and potentially leading to modifications or restrictions on the deal. The companies will need to demonstrate that the acquisition is beneficial to the market and does not harm competition, providing comprehensive information, addressing concerns, and cooperating with regulators.
